Product Description

Grows to 100 Ft. A classic shade tree. It is a stately tree with yellow fall colour. This tree has a high, spreading canopy creating an elegant shape. An excellent lawn or street tree. Also called the White Elm.

Features

  • Packet contains 40 hand-sorted, high-quality seeds.
  • Broad and vase-shaped in form, with a textured gray bark.
  • Thrives in zones 2 to 9 in full sun to partial shade and moist, well-drained soil.

1Don't buy unless you can determine the cultivar
By bluetomato1234
Dutch Elm Disease is the cause of the massive reduction in the number of American Elms in the United States. There are over 40 cultivars, or sub-species, of this elm; the ONLY types verified to show resistance to Dutch Elm disease (DED) are the cultivars Valley Forge, Jefferson, Princeton, and New Harmony, with American Liberty being currently disputed as a Dutch Elm resistant strain. The seller here does NOT tell you which cultivar this is. Great, so you get 33 out of 40 of your seeds to germinate. How many will live to be 10 years old once planted if they are not a resistant strain and get DED?
